Church downspout repair services involve inspecting and fixing the vertical pipes that direct rainwater from the roof to the ground. Over time, these downspouts can develop issues such as cracks, rust, or detachments, which can lead to water spilling improperly or pooling around the foundation. Repair work typically includes sealing leaks, reattaching loose sections, replacing damaged parts, and ensuring the entire system is securely connected. Properly functioning downspouts help manage rainwater runoff effectively, preventing water damage to the building’s exterior and interior.

Many common problems can be addressed through professional downspout repairs. Cracks or holes in the pipes can cause leaks that damage siding, cause mold growth, or create puddles that attract pests. Disconnected or loose downspouts may not direct water away from the foundation, increasing the risk of basement flooding or foundation shifting. Blockages caused by debris or corrosion can also hinder proper drainage, leading to overflow during heavy rains. Repair services help resolve these issues, restoring the system’s ability to channel water safely away from the property.

The overview below groups typical Church Downspout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Clearwater, FL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or repairs such as fixing leaks or loose brackets, local pros typ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the damage and accessibility.

Moderate Repairs - Larger repairs like replacing sections of damaged downspouts or addressing clogs usually cost between $600 and $1,200. These projects are common for homeowners needing more extensive work.

Full Replacement - Replacing entire sections or entire downspout systems can range from $1,200 to $3,000, with many projects in the middle of this range. Larger, more complex projects may push costs higher but are less frequent.

Complete System Overhaul - For comprehensive upgrades or full system replacements, local contractors often charge $3,000 and up, with larger jobs exceeding $5,000. These are typically reserved for extensive repairs or upgrades to older systems.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of downspout repairs do local contractors handle? Local contractors can address issues such as leaks, clogs, broken sections, and improper installation of downspouts to ensure proper drainage and prevent water damage.

How can I tell if my downspouts need repair? Signs include water pooling around the foundation, visible cracks or rust on downspouts, sagging or disconnected sections, and overflowing during rainstorms.

Are there different materials used for downspout repair? Yes, local service providers often work with various materials like aluminum, copper, vinyl, or steel, depending on the existing system and homeowner preferences.

What causes downspouts to require repairs over time? Common causes include weather-related wear, debris buildup, corrosion, and accidental damage from landscaping or nearby activities.
